good attempt: colors are great + girl is interesting/pretty, technically her eyes are not as sharp as they should (compare the detailsrichness of the eyebrown with the sharpness of the hairstrains) - regarding composition more room on the left is needed - that part of her arm right below should be croped away - Klaus

As a candid shot, you have the focus bang on, The colour of her top works well with the blurred background. However for 'Happy Canada Day' she doesn't look amazingly happy does she.

Also, her lower arm to the left of the image has been cut off, I can live with the right arm in the position it is, but I feel a little more time to compose the image would have worked in your favour.
